In 1996, University of Delaware researchers Timothy Frick and Douglas Tallamy revealed a study within the journal Entomological News.


They'd collected and identified the kills from six bug zappers at numerous sites throughout suburban Newark, Del., throughout the summer season of 1994. Of the nearly 14,000 insects that were electrocuted and counted, only 31 (0.22 percent) were mosquitoes and biting gnats. The biggest number (6,670, or 48 %) have been midges and harmless, aquatic insects from close by our bodies of water. The researchers claimed that killing this many harmless insects would disturb nearby ecosystems. In line with Tallamy, Zap Zone Defender most species of mosquitoes aren't attracted to ultraviolet gentle, and certain species only chunk during the day. Tallamy claims that bug zappers are nugatory for indoor-outdoor zapper decreasing biting flies, exact a heavy toll on non-target insects and are counterproductive to consumers and the ecosystem.
